在master节点上,在/home/hadoop/data/zookeeper/data/myid写入节点标记:1
时间: 2024-11-25 13:15:15 浏览: 5
在Hadoop集群中,ZooKeeper是一个分布式协调服务,用于维护配置信息、命名空间和服务发现等。Master节点通常是指HDFS或YARN集群中的NameNode或ResourceManager。当你提到要在`/home/hadoop/data/zookeeper/data/myid`路径下写入节点标记为1,这意味着你想在这个目录下的myid文件中设置 ZooKeeper 节点的身份标识。
在ZooKeeper中,每个服务器都会有一个唯一的ID(myid),这是为了区分集群中的各个节点。要完成这个操作,你需要通过SSH登录到该Master节点,然后使用文本编辑器(如`vi`、`nano`或`sed`)来更新文件内容:
```bash
# 登录到Master节点
ssh hadoop@<master_node_ip>
# 进入指定目录
cd /home/hadoop/data/zookeeper/data/
# 创建或编辑myid文件(如果不存在)
echo 1 > myid
# 或者直接修改已有内容
sudo vi myid # 使用vi编辑器
# 或
echo 1 | sudo tee myid # 使用管道追加新行
# 保存并退出
exit # 如果使用vi
```
完成后,记得检查文件内容是否为1,确认节点标记已经设置好。
阅读全文